CAMBRIDGE, MD – Police are investigating a shooting incident that took place this weekend in Cambridge.

On Saturday, Cambridge Police Department (CPD) officers responded to a Shot Spotter Alert in the 700 block of Douglas Street, where multiple shots were reportedly fired.

Officers found a residence struck by gunfire and several spent shell casings in the area. A witness reported seeing a subject chasing another with a gun, and either a truck or an SUV leaving the scene. Police are seeking information from witnesses, who may remain anonymous.
